- Mass Effect 3: Citadel – Single Player DLC
When a sinister conspiracy targets Commander Shepard, you and your team must uncover the truth, through battles and intrigue that range from the glamour of the Citadel’s Wards to the top-secret Council Archives. Uncover the truth and fight alongside your squad – as well as the cast from the original Mass Effect and Mass Effect 2, including Urdnot Wrex!
When the adventure is over, reconnect with your favorite characters from the Mass Effect Trilogy, try your luck at the Citadel’s Silver Coast Casino, blow off steam in the Armax Combat Arena, or explore and furnish Shepard’s own living quarters on the Citadel. With unique content and cinematics featuring your friends and romance interests in the Mass Effect trilogy, Mass Effect 3: Citadel offers one final chance to see the characters you have known for years and rekindle romances.
Mass Effect 3: Citadel will release worldwide on March 5th on Xbox 360, PC and PS3 (on March 6th on PS3 in Europe). Price: $14.99, 1200MS points and 1200 BW points. - Quote :
- Mass Effect 3: Reckoning – Multiplayer DLC
Prepare for the Reckoning! Newfound allies join the multiplayer war for survival in Mass Effect 3: Reckoning. The Geth Juggernaut, Cabal Vanguard, Talon Mercenary, Alliance Infiltration Unit, and more take up arms to stop the Reaper threat. Smash your enemies with the Biotic Hammer as you lay waste to the battlefield as the Krogan Warlord.
Wield 7 new weapons for multiplayer, including the Geth Spitfire Assault Rifle, Venom Shotgun, Lancer Assault Rifle, and amplify your arsenal with new equipment and weapon mods featuring the Geth Scanner and Assault Rifle Omni-blade.

| Well... got the Krogan Warlord, Talon Merc, and Awakened Collector right away. All are actually pretty fun and unique to play. Definitely made for team work and not soloing (tho I think if you're smart enough you can with the Talon and Warlord).
Krogan Warlord: Strengths: Close range, massive damage, some area damage, has health regen, wouldn't worry too much about cooldown times even tho they're long (your hammer is your primary weapon). Weaknesses: Is kinda slow on the mobility like most Krogans, can't take cover (due to massive size), lots of enemies can whittle away his shields and health quickly (the health regen is very weak), you basically want teammates to redirect fire from the krogan, and lastly there isn't THAT big of a radius on the hammer's attack.
I'm a little iffy on the whole close range mass damage bit. You can set your character up to do a little more area with less damage, but bottom line the character was made for taking down heavier opponents. The problem is... these heavier opponents can auto kill you so what's the point of making such a close range character? Now... I have a theory and have yet to test it... but I think the Krogan Warlord and Geth Prime characters might be immune to auto kills due to their massive size.
Awakened Collector: Strengths: Lots of damage ability, and very mobile. The Dark Sphere can do a shit ton of dmg when you detonate it (more than the recon mine I believe). Weaknesses: Low health and shields, reliability on teammates, not much support ability.
If you like the adept... this is its comeback.
Talon Merc: Strengths: Support, mobility, and damage. Weaknesses: Low health and shield.
Now this was a really unique character to play as. You have an omni-bow which basically fires unlimited arrows (they aren't that strong mind you). Single tapping melee releases a group of arrows, holding aims one stronger at a spec enemy. You have two power options to coat your arrows in... you'd have to play with it to understand. Your arrow specials use grenade slots or something, as do the trip mines you're given. Trip mines do a lot of damage and you can set up to 3 of em. Nice for setting up traps and fortifying a location you and your teammates want to hold up in. Very weird class to play. | |
